Hotel employees seek a better deal

Special Correspondent

PANAJI: A two-day founding conference of the Hotel Employees Federation of India will be held at Arpora in north Goa on October 4 and 5.

At the conference, the federation will formally demand that a national commission be constituted to look into the plight of hotel employees and seek remedial statutory provisions.

Chief Minister Digambar Kamat will inaugurate the conference on October 4. It will be attended by around 160 representatives of hotel unions.

Joint convener of the federation Subhash Naik Jorge said here on Monday, “For the first time, hotel trade unions in the country , irrespective of their affiliations to different Central trade unions, have joined hands to form a federation and bring to focus at the national level the plight of hotel employees, particularly in the unorganised sector.”

Contract system

“The federation is totally opposed to the ‘casualisation of work force in the hotel industry , contract system of employment and outsourcing,” said Mr. Jorge.

The federation intends to take up issues such as lack of job security, need for rationalisation of salary structure, regulation of working hours and availability of facilities and benefits.
